    Canon and Mrs Grigson in the Vicarage Garden at Pelynt with their seven sons, six of whom died serving their country. The youngest son, Geoffrey, was the only one to live to old age.

    Standing L-R: Claude, Kenneth, Wilfred, Lionel
    Seated L-R: William, Aubrey, John, Mary
    Front on Ground: Geoffrey
